‘Sublime and beautiful” described both the setting and the theme for the Princeton University Art Museum’s annual gala, which this year coincided with the winter exhibition “Pastures Green and Dark Satanic Mills: The British Passion for Landscape.” The exhibit, on view through April 24, features landscape masterpieces from the 17th to 20th centuries.

The black-tie event started with cocktails in the museum and moved to Prospect House for dinner and dancing. Funds raised by the gala support the museum’s ongoing free programming, including more than 145,000 visitors annually and many others who take advantage of the museum’s online resources.
